How much do laborer jobs pay per hour?

As of Jul 6, 2026, the average hourly pay for laborer in Springfield, OH is $17.17,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$14.52 and $19.04 per hour,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What are laborers?

Laborers are workers who perform a variety of physically demanding tasks on construction sites, warehouses, factories, or other settings. Their duties often include loading and unloading materials, cleaning and preparing job sites, assisting skilled tradespeople, and operating some tools or equipment. Laborers play a critical role in ensuring projects run smoothly by supporting different phases of work as needed. The job typically requires physical stamina, the ability to follow instructions, and a willingness to work in various weather conditions. No formal education is usually required, but on-the-job training is common.

While both Laborers and Construction Workers perform manual tasks on construction sites, Laborers typically handle basic physical work such as loading, unloading, and site cleanup, often without formal certifications. Construction Workers may have more specialized skills or roles within the construction industry, sometimes requiring specific training or certifications. Both roles are essential in the building process and frequently overlap in work environment and industry usage.

Job Title: General Laborer - 1st shift $19 to $20 an hour

Job Description

As a General Laborer, you will perform a range of tasks within the shop, ensuring that each day brings new challenges and opportunities. Your duties will include sweeping shop floors, properly discarding scrap, moving large scrap containers with a forklift, supporting the shipping and receiving department, making cuts on saws for the welding team, deburring parts, and working in the paint booth by blasting, priming, and painting.

Responsibilities

  • Sweep shop floors and properly discard scrap.
  • Move large scrap containers with forklift.
  • Support the shipping and receiving department by packaging and labeling.
  • Make cuts on saw for welding team.
  • Deburr parts as needed.
  • Work in paint booth by blasting, priming, and painting.

Essential Skills

  • Ability to perform shop math, including adding and subtracting decimals and fractions.
  • Ability to read tape measure down to the 32nd.
  • At least 6 months of experience in a manufacturing setting requiring physical lifting.
  • Operation of hand and power tools.
  • Valid drivers license

Additional Skills & Qualifications

  • Experience in blasting, priming, and painting in a paint booth is a plus.
  • Sit down forklift experience is a plus.

Why Work Here?

Enjoy cost-effective medical, dental, and vision insurance along with opportunities for career growth.

Work Environment

The work environment is non-climate controlled, meaning it can be hot in the summer and cold in the winter, but it is well-lit.

Job Type & Location

This is a Contract to Hire position based out of Springfield, OH.
